WebApr 11, 2024 · Operator overloading. Kotlin allows you to provide custom implementations for the predefined set of operators on types. These operators have predefined symbolic representation (like + or *) and precedence.To implement an operator, provide a member function or an extension function with a specific name for the corresponding type. This … WebBinary Operators Overloading in C++. The binary operators take two arguments and following are the examples of Binary operators. You use binary operators very frequently …
Solved Project 2 - Fraction class with operator overloading - Chegg
WebApr 28, 2024 · Accessing list elements using square bracket calls the overloaded operators get() and set(), while in calls contains().. What is operator overloading. In programming, overloading means adding extra meaning to something that is already exists. For example, operator overloading allows us to use + to do something meaningful for our custom data … WebApr 10, 2024 · Basics of operator overloading. The C# language has a simple structure for the overload of operators, basically you define a static method on a type whose return type and parameters are the type itself. For example: public static operator (Name> typeName) where TypeName is the enclosing type, and … sketchers in north spokane
Overloading operator<< - must be a binary operator - Stack Overflow
WebApr 11, 2024 · One of the reasons: it works better with implicit type conversion. An Example: You have a complex class with an overloaded operator*. If you want to write 2.0 * aComplexNumber, you need the operator* to be a non-member function. Another reason: less coupling. Non-member-functions a less closely coupled than member functions. WebApr 28, 2024 · Accessing list elements using square bracket calls the overloaded operators get() and set(), while in calls contains().. What is operator overloading. In programming, … WebOverloading binary operators (C++ only) You overload a binary operator with either a nonstatic member function that has one parameter, or a nonmember function that has … sketchers in port charlotte fl